Output 109a1d9dac6c3d6e6e10f54e1ded010b95261fb0910513d4963f176f0ab94994:2

value
22674458
script pubkey
OP_0 OP_PUSHBYTES_20 4c588124a51724ff5aa39766c0bcea2879b01dc4
address
bc1qf3vgzf99zuj07k4rjanvp0829pumq8wyujc703
transaction
109a1d9dac6c3d6e6e10f54e1ded010b95261fb0910513d4963f176f0ab94994
confirmations
38100
spent
true